Auto merge of #10478 - Jarcho:block_eq, r=xFrednet
`SpanlessEq` improvements
fixes #9775
Also includes a simplification to `consts::constant`'s interface since I was already touching the code.
At the start of `eq_expr` the check:
```rust
if !self.inner.allow_side_effects && left.span.ctxt() != right.span.ctxt() {
return false;
}
```
was removed. This was added in 49e2501 to handle `cfg` macros. This is better handled by the newly added `check_ctxt`.
changelog: [various lints]: Don't consider different `cfg!` expansions to be the same unless they are for the same config.
changelog: [various lints]: Don't consider the expansion of two different macros to be equal, even when they expand to the same token sequence.
changelog: [various lints]: Don't consider two blocks to be equal if they contain disabled code or empty macro expansions, unless those section contain the exact same token sequence.
